... There are two new 13″ MacBooks, and are available now. The 2.0GHz Intel Core 2 Duo version is $1299. It has 2GB RAM, 160GB hard drive, the NVIDIA GeForce 9400M Graphics Processor and the new glass Multi-touch trackpad. The 2.4GHz Intel Core 2 Duo version is $1599. It has 2GB RAM, 250GB hard drive, the NVIDIA GeForce 9400M Graphics Processor and the new glass Multi-touch trackpad. ...
